Asia-Pacific mixed, Hang Seng rallies 300 points

Stock exchanges across Asia-Pacific region were mixed in the afternoon trading on Thursday as investors digested the Federal Reserve's call to hike interest rates by a quarter-point despite the recent turmoil in the banking sector. The markets appeared to struggle for direction after US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en said that the government is not considering insuring all uninsured bank deposits.

Japan's Nikkei 225 slipped 0.17%, and the Australian S&P/ASX 200 fell 0.67%. South Korea's Kospi was flat at 7:18 am CET. In mainland China, the Shenzhen Composite rose 0.64%, while Shanghai Composite added 0.35%.

Hong Kong's Hang Seng rallied 1.52% or 300 points, with Tencent Holdings Ltd. surging 7.72% after posting its fourth-quarter financial report. The dollar declined 0.54% against Japanese yen, to sell at ¥130.74800 at 7:22 am CET.
